Author Comments

This was sort of an experimental game I made, which changes based on the season and time of day that you play it. It's also low enough memory to fit on the Sony PSP, if you haven't upgraded to the PSVita yet and still have a console with Flash player!

I found this to be a fun little time waster that you can come back to whenever, especially as you can try it at noon while it's super easy, or play it at 2AM when you can barely see a thing.

Kwing responds:

This game was made more of an experiment. I'm dabbling with making games that change depending on the date, and this is my first real dive into the idea. Ultimately I would like to create some kind of hour-sized dungeon crawler with level design that changes every day, especially if I could have players go in and interact with each other. Anyway, yeah, what I have right now is extremely simple.

The acorn you're talking about is an autumn leaf, which means that you're playing in the fall. In the winter, spring, and summer, there are different effects on the gameplay. Perhaps I'll find a way to add more gimmicks in the future based on different mechanics.

As for the whole limited visibility maze thing, I'm actually going to be using this as an interlude between random battles in an RPG that I'm working on, so if you like the idea, you'll probably like my new game. Both this game and the one coming out are also PSP compatible, if you're wondering why there's no sound (I'm trying to create low memory games).
